Key to the Spanish conquest of Mexico in the 1500s was that the Spanish a. formed alliances with the enemies of the Aztecs. b. s

hared a common religion with the majority of the native population. c. began by cultivating the trust of the Aztecs and then destroyed their empire. d. understood the importance of forming economic ties with the Aztecs.

Answer:

A. they formed an alliance with the enemies of the Aztecs

Explanation:

    The conquest of the Aztecs took place between 1519 and 1521 and was one of the episodes of the Spanish invasion and colonization of America. The great Aztec Empire had been built by Mesoamerican peoples from the fourteenth century. With their conquest, the Spanish began the colonization of the region that today corresponds to Mexico.

    After a great defeat against the Aztecs in 1520, Cortes did not fully reorganize his forces until 1521, when he formed a gigantic army of thousands of Tlaxcaltec warriors (enemies of the Aztecs). In addition, he built numerous vessels to surround Tenochtitlán (the Aztec capital was on an island in the middle of a large lake that no longer exists). Reports told of violent fighting taking place in the streets of Tenochtitlán.

   The result of the siege of Tenochtitlán was the Spanish victory. The new emperor, whose name was Cuahtemoc, was taken prisoner, and from there the Spaniards moved on to conquer the other smaller cities controlled by the Aztecs. With the conquest of this people, the Spanish established in the region the Vice Kingdom of New Spain, which was initially administered by Cortes himself.

In which country is it said that finding a spider web on christmas morning brings good luck
andreyandreev [35.5K]

Answer:

Ukraine and Germany

Explanation:

Spiders may seem like a more specific Halloween ornament, but eight-legged creatures actually play an important role in other parties. We have discovered the tradition of "Christmas spiders."

It is based on a European folk tale that has been attributed to several countries, often Ukraine and Germany. In a version of the Christmas spider story, a widowed mother and her children were too poor to decorate their Christmas tree, and friendly spiders wove elaborate nets on a fir tree. When the family woke up on Christmas morning, they opened the curtains and sunlight illuminated the cobwebs, turning them into silver and gold (sometimes it is said to be the origin of the garlands). The family had good fortune thereafter. Other versions affirm that it was Santa Claus or Jesus himself who transformed the networks so that they did not bother the mother.

It is likely that the legend is related to the idea that spiders give good luck. Whatever the real reason, according to various sources, Ukrainians decorate their Christmas trees with spider-shaped ornaments (often made of precious stones) to this day
